Usługi pośrednictwa pracy IT Zdalne zespoły Abonament rekrutacyjny O nas Kontakt Wszystkie prace Praca w IT Przykłady CV Nasz blog 2 Case Studies

Wznów: Automation QA Tester z JavaScript

Lokalizacja: Polska

Stawka: 3600 USD brutto

O MNIE

Motywowany inżynier testowania oprogramowania z około 8-letnim udanym doświadczeniem w branży, ze szczególnym naciskiem na testowanie manualne. Doświadczenie w automatycznym testowaniu aplikacji internetowych przy użyciu narzędzi takich jak Selenium WebDriver, Cucumber, Java, Junit (w przeszłości), Node.js, Jest, Puppeteer, Protractor, WDIO. Obszar mojej zawodowej wiedzy obejmuje testowanie automatyczne, testowanie funkcjonalne, testowanie interfejsu graficznego, testowanie użyteczności, testowanie integracyjne, testowanie API. Doświadczony w weryfikacji wymagań, tworzeniu przypadków testowych, wykonywaniu testów, śledzeniu i raportowaniu defektów. Doświadczenie w pracy nad projektami z zastosowaniem metodyk i praktyk Agile. Szybko się uczę, potrafię spełniać napięte terminy, jestem samodzielny, odpowiedzialny. Zespół, silne umiejętności interpersonalne i komunikacyjne (zarówno pisemne, jak i ustne). Mentorowanie i nauczanie studentów oraz bardziej doświadczonych inżynierów.

PODSUMOWANIE UMIEJĘTNOŚCI

Umiejętności techniczne:

  • Języki: Node.Js, Java (1.5.x, 1.6.x, 1.7.x), SQL, HTML, XML, XSD, JSON, UML
  • Technologie internetowe: HTML, JavaScript, CSS
  • Serwery WWW/Aplikacji: Apache Tomcat 5.x
  • Bazy danych: MongoDB, MySQL, PostgreSQL, Microsoft SQL Server, SQLite
  • Frameworki testowe: Jest, Puppeteer, WDIO, Jasmine, Mocha, Protractor, JUnit 4.x, TestNG
  • Narzędzia do automatyzacji budowy: Npm, Maven, Gradle
  • Środowiska programistyczne: VSCode, Eclipse 4.5, Intellij IDEA
  • Narzędzia do testowania wydajności: Jmeter+Blazemeter, Artillery, Axios
  • Inne narzędzia do testowania: Raporter Allure, SouceLab
  • Narzędzia: Selenium IDE, SoapUI, RoboMongo, Fiddler, Cucumber
  • Inne narzędzia: Docker, Eslint, Prettier, TeamCity, Jenkins, Serwer HTTP Apache, VMware, VirtualBox, Confluence, JIRA, Mingle, Bamboo, QTP

DOŚWIADCZENIE ZAWODOWE

Stanowisko: Inżynier Testów Automatyzacji

07.2020 – obecnie

Projekt: Aplikacja internetowa dla firm sprzedających detalicznie.

  • Konfiguracja automatycznych testów od podstaw przy użyciu Node.JS + Jest + Puppeteer
  • Ustalanie warunków wstępnych dla testów automatycznych przy użyciu wywołań API
  • Codzienne analizowanie wyników testów

Narzędzia i technologie: Node.JS, VSCode, Puppeteer, Jest, Chai, Axios, Allure Report, Eslint

Stanowisko: Inżynier Testów Automatyzacji

02.2019 – 07.2020

Projekt: Aplikacja internetowa dla firmy oferującej doradztwo biznesowe i usługi.

  • Wykonywanie i utrzymanie istniejących skryptów automatyzacji przy użyciu Node.JS + Protractor + Cucumber
  • Konfiguracja testów wydajnościowych przy użyciu Jmeter + Blazemeter
  • Ustawianie testów automatycznych dla wywołań API
  • Testowanie CrossBrowsing w SauceLab

Narzędzia i technologie: Node.JS, VSCode, Cucumber, BDD, Jmeter, Blazemetrer, SauseLab, Request, Npm, Docker, Chai.

Stanowisko: Inżynier Testów Automatyzacji

05.2018 – 02.2019

Projekt: Aplikacja internetowa dla firmy rozrywkowej.

  • Wykonywanie i utrzymanie istniejących skryptów automatyzacji przy użyciu Java + TestNG + Selenium WD
  • Konfiguracja testów automatycznych od podstaw dla wywołań API
  • Wsparcie testowania CrossBrowsing
  • Konfiguracja testów automatycznych dla analizy danych Google Analytics

Narzędzia i technologie: Java 8, Intellij Idea IDE, Selenium Web Driver, Maven, TestNG, BrowserMob.

Stanowisko: Inżynier Testów

04.2017 – 05.2018

Projekt: Aplikacja internetowa dla jednej z najbardziej znanych firm reasekuracyjnych.

  • Wykonywanie i utrzymanie istniejących skryptów automatyzacji przy użyciu QTP i Java + Selenium WD
  • Konfiguracja testów automatycznych od podstaw
  • Ustawianie Bamboo dla testów automatyzacji

Narzędzia i technologie: Java 8, Intellij Idea IDE, QTP, TeamCity, Selenium Web Driver, Perforce, BDD, Cucumber, Bamboo, Gradle.

Stanowisko: Inżynier Testów Automatyzacji Oprogramowania

03.2016 – 04.2017

Projekt: Aplikacja internetowa dla dostawcy usług prawnych, który ma integrację z starszymi wersjami aplikacji i różnymi uprawnieniami użytkowników.

  • Wykonywanie i utrzymanie skryptów automatyzacji
  • Mentorowanie i udział w przeglądach kodu
  • Analiza wymagań
  • Codzienne i tygodniowe raportowanie
  • Codzienna analiza podstawowych scenariuszy testowych
  • Wznoszenie/weryfikacja defektów
  • Szkolenie i ciągły rozwój młodszych inżynierów testów automatyzacji.

Narzędzia i technologie: Java 7-8, Intellij Idea IDE, Jenkins CI, Selenium Web Driver, TFS, BDD, Cucumber, Kanban.

Stanowisko: Inżynier Testowania Oprogramowania

09.2015 – 02.2016

Projekt: Key-tester dla aplikacji internetowej obsługującej proces rekrutacji w firmie z trudną integracją z innymi usługami.

  • Testowanie interfejsu użytkownika
  • Analiza wymagań
  • Testowanie regresji Testowanie w różnych przeglądarkach
  • Wznoszenie/weryfikacja defektów
  • Codzienne testy podstawowe Tworzenie/aktualizacja przypadków testowych
  • Codzienne raportowanie
  • Udział w spotkaniach dotyczących precyzowania wymagań

Narzędzia i technologie: Jenkins, Jira, KB, Swagger, PostgreSQL, Confluence, HTML, JS, CSS, JSON, Java.

Stanowisko: Inżynier Testowania Oprogramowania

06.2015 – 08.2015

Opis projektu: Key-tester na portalu oceny poziomu starszeństwa wewnętrznego z trudną integracją z innymi systemami. Aplikacja ma około 15 grup uprawnień i różne role użytkowników.

  • Testowanie interfejsu użytkownika
  • Analiza wymagań
  • Testowanie regresji
  • Testowanie w różnych przeglądarkach
  • Wznoszenie/weryfikacja defektów TRR (Testowanie, Rekomendowanie, Raportowanie)
  • Tworzenie/aktualizacja przypadków testowych
  • Sesje demonstracyjne i transfer wiedzy
  • Wdrażanie buildów w środowisku QA

Narzędzia i technologie: Jira, TeamCity, Microsoft SQL Server, Confluence.

Stanowisko: Inżynier Testowania Oprogramowania

05.2014 – 06.2015

Projekt: Strona internetowa umożliwiająca konsumentom porównywanie cen różnych produktów, w tym lotów, hoteli, wynajmu samochodów i podróży. I back-office dla głównej strony.

  • Testowanie za pomocą API Testowanie interfejsu użytkownika
  • Analiza wymagań
  • Testowanie regresji
  • Testowanie w różnych przeglądarkach
  • Wznoszenie/weryfikacja defektów

Narzędzia i technologie: Mingle, RoboMongo, XML, JSON, SoapUI, Flowdock, Confluence, Jenkins.

Dołącz do społeczności Znoydzem.

Aplikuj jako Specjalista ds